INDUSTRIAL RISK INSURERS v. HARTFORD STEAM BOILER INSPECTION & INS. CO.

(SC 16155)

258 Conn. 101 (2001)

INDUSTRIAL RISK INSURERS v. HARTFORD STEAM BOILER INSPECTION AND INSURANCE COMPANY HARTFORD STEAM BOILER INSPECTION AND INSURANCE COMPANY v. INDUSTRIAL RISK INSURERS

Supreme Court of Connecticut.

Officially released September 18, 2001.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Lawrence Zelle, pro hac vice, with whom were Linda L. Morkan, Richard L. Voelbel, pro hac vice, and, on the brief, Michelle K. Enright, pro hac vice, and Louis I. Parley, for the appellant (Industrial Risk Insurers).

Thomas E. Birsic, with whom was Maurice T. Fitz-Maurice, for the appellee (Hartford Steam Boiler Inspection and Insurance Company).

Borden, Norcott, Katz, Palmer and Vertefeuille, JS.


Opinion

VERTEFEUILLE, J.

In this appeal, Industrial Risk Insurers (Industrial Risk), appeals from the judgment of the trial court denying its application to vacate an arbitration award and granting the application to confirm the award filed by Hartford Steam Boiler Inspection and Insurance Company (Hartford Steam Boiler).1 On appeal, Industrial Risk claims that the trial court improperly confirmed the arbitrator's award...
